Galooli Live centralizes telemetry from distributed assets to create a standardized data layer that serves as the foundation for a digital twin and actionable analytics. The platform ingests and organizes data flows across sites, enforces consistent storage and schema standards, and enables logic-based flags and alarms that can be tailored to customer-specific thresholds and conditions. By converting heterogeneous status updates into normalized records, Galooli Live makes it possible to detect abnormal behavior and potential malfunctions in real time and to push notifications to stakeholders. The solution also produces template-based and custom periodic reports that emphasize actionable metrics, helping teams transition from periodic audits to continuous monitoring. Agnostic to specific hardware vendors, the product supports visual monitoring via a real-time map overlay and a web and mobile interface, improving asset visibility, site management, fleet oversight, and operational efficiency across distributed infrastructure.
